Choosing the correct furniture for the boardroom is very important for creating the ideal business image. It also doesn't just provides a comfortable environment for employees but also contributes to creating a positive impression on customers. Selecting the right decorations for your conference room therefore is something that requires careful consideration.

One of the first things when purchasing boardroom furniture is the size of the space. Your chosen furniture should fit nicely get more info without overcrowding the room, and ensuring there is enough space to move freely and comfortably is critical.

Tables form the main part of boardroom furniture. The dimension of your table should be in accordance to the room’s size and capacity to seat. Timber tables are a traditional selection, while glass-top tables give a modern vibe.

Boardroom chairs should not only look professional but also be comfortable. Given that employees often have to sit for extended periods. Comfortable chairs that help support posture and back health are an excellent pick.

Additionally, choose furniture that depict your company's image and ethos. This could involve color schemes that tie in your branding, and high-quality furnishings that presents your company's degree of professionalism.

In terms of storage, add in clever storage solutions such as shelving units, bookshelves, and filing systems. These can keep the room neat and orderly, which is crucial for productive working.

Finally, remember that the boardroom is an extension of your firm. Therefore, the furniture should be functional and also have aesthetic value. Investing in high-quality, stylish boardroom furniture can boost the overall look of your office, reflect your brand, and impress clients.
